3051660
0xfe21393deebd81f1ecf826f701e80804164bd1e9f2134c5c56fa6492b74a79fd
Transactions0
Height3051660
Confirmations13245278
Timestamp1113 days 4 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x28b276e0e89b047b
Bits
Difficulty0xcba4427